Understanding Uneven Skin Texture

Uneven skin texture refers to irregularities on the skin’s surface that affect how smooth or refined it appears. These irregularities may include rough patches, enlarged pores, shallow scars, or areas of uneven thickness. While skin tone deals with color, texture focuses on the physical feel and surface quality of the skin.

Over time, the skin’s natural renewal process slows down, and collagen production decreases. This leads to weakened structural support and a less uniform surface. Environmental exposure and past skin inflammation can also contribute to long-term textural changes that become more noticeable with age.

Because texture concerns originate in the deeper layers of the skin, effective improvement often requires treatments that target both surface and structural levels.

How RF Microneedling Works to Improve Skin Texture

RF microneedling is a dual-action skin rejuvenation procedure that combines microneedling with radiofrequency energy. During the treatment, fine needles create controlled microchannels in the skin while radiofrequency energy is delivered into deeper layers.

These micro-injuries activate the body’s natural healing response, encouraging the production of collagen and elastin. At the same time, the radiofrequency energy gently heats the dermis, stimulating deeper tissue remodeling.

This combination allows the skin to repair itself from within, replacing damaged structures with healthier, more organized tissue. As a result, the surface gradually becomes smoother and more refined.

Collagen Remodeling for Smoother Skin

Collagen plays a central role in determining skin texture. When collagen fibers weaken or become disorganized, the skin can appear uneven and rough.

RF microneedling stimulates fibroblast activity, which is responsible for producing new collagen. As fresh collagen develops, it fills in irregularities and strengthens the skin’s support structure.

Over time, this remodeling process helps create a more uniform surface. The skin becomes smoother, more resilient, and better able to maintain its shape, reducing the appearance of texture-related concerns.

Refining Enlarged Pores and Surface Irregularities

Enlarged pores are a major contributor to uneven skin texture. They often result from excess oil production, loss of elasticity, or buildup within the pore structure.

RF microneedling helps refine pore appearance by tightening the surrounding skin and stimulating collagen production around pore walls. As the skin becomes firmer, pores appear smaller and less visible.

This improvement contributes to a more polished and even surface, enhancing overall skin smoothness.

Improving Acne Scars and Textural Marks

Acne scars are one of the most challenging forms of uneven texture. They occur when inflammation damages deeper layers of the skin, leading to indentations or raised areas.

RF microneedling works by encouraging deep dermal remodeling. The controlled micro-injuries stimulate the body’s repair process, gradually rebuilding collagen in scarred areas.

As new tissue forms, the skin’s surface becomes more level and even. While results develop gradually, consistent collagen stimulation helps significantly reduce the visibility of textural scarring over time.

Enhancing Skin Cell Turnover for Surface Renewal

Healthy skin texture depends on regular cell turnover, where old cells are replaced by new ones. When this process slows, dead cells accumulate on the surface, making the skin feel rough and uneven.

RF microneedling accelerates this renewal process by activating the skin’s natural healing response. As the skin repairs microchannels created during treatment, it sheds damaged cells and replaces them with fresh ones.

This renewal helps smooth the skin’s surface and improve overall texture, creating a softer and more refined appearance.

Strengthening Skin Elasticity for Better Texture

Elasticity is essential for maintaining smooth and even skin. When the skin loses elasticity, it becomes less able to maintain a uniform surface, leading to sagging or irregular texture.

RF microneedling enhances elasticity by stimulating both collagen and elastin production. These proteins help the skin remain firm, flexible, and resilient.

Improved elasticity allows the skin to better maintain its structure, reducing the appearance of uneven texture and supporting long-term smoothness.

Deep Tissue Remodeling for Lasting Improvement

One of the most powerful aspects of RF microneedling is its ability to remodel deep skin tissue. Radiofrequency energy penetrates into the dermis, where it triggers collagen contraction and regeneration.

This deep stimulation helps reorganize the skin’s structural framework, making it stronger and more uniform. As the tissue rebuilds, the skin gradually becomes smoother and more even.

Because the process targets deeper layers, improvements tend to be long-lasting and continue developing over time.
